Can be performed on FBC sample Purpose of Test: Morphological assessment of blood cells gives diagnostic information that cannot be obtained from the FBC parameters alone. Some cells cannot be differentiated by modern analyser technology and need blood film examination to be correctly identified. Important sample information such as cell clumping or agglutination, EDTA and storage effects and other artefactual changes can be identified by blood film examination and used for result interpretation. |
